There are quite a few pictures on Pinterest of Bento Boxes - generally lunch.  We have adopted and adapted the idea for breakfast and snacks.  These are silicone cupcake cups inside a plastic pencil box.  Some days we set the cups on a divided plastic plate.  The cereal is Kashi.  Benjamin loves it.
These three stairs lead into a den at the bottom.  We had a gate at the top until this week.  I explained to Benjamin that if he would use the railing (behind him) and go slowly, we would leave the gate down and he could have unlimited access to either area.  He has done extremely well - - stops at stairs and proceeds slowly.  Hopefully that continues so we don't have an accident.
I am sure you are glad I posted a picture of raw meat!  However, I made a BIG pot of Ragu sauce with meatballs.  The hamburger was 97% fat free!  Obviously there were some leftovers - - enough for six more meals.  It doesn't take very much time to cook extra.  Then it is such a blessing to have a quick meal in the freezer.

Since it is the first day of the new year, I had to cook what is expected of a good Southern woman - - - even if I was raised in upstate NY.  However, my precious mother-in-law would come back from the grave to haunt me if I didn't cook the traditional meal.  Since I don't like greens at all, she conceded that boiled cabbage was an acceptable substitute.  You notice we added carrots.
Here are Bill's black-eyed peas cooked from scratch.
And since I don't appreciate the taste of B-E peas, I make Great Northern Beans for me and my older daughter.  They have ketchup, a bit of brown sugar, some onion, ham and other seasonings.  I found a small package of cubed ham at Publix - - - just the right amount for both beans.
 For additional protein, we made baked Macaroni and Cheese with Barilla Plus Pasta.  Here is the recipe from Taste of Home if you want it.  It's delicious!
